Input/Output: How to Succeed as an Introvert.

“On the other hand, introverts have to find the places where they are comfortable stretching themselves and pushing themselves a little bit, while giving themselves the recharge time that they need. If you know you’re going to be leading a company meeting for three hours, you make sure you don’t schedule something else for the three hours after it. Honoring your temperament enough to do that will go a long way towards preventing burnout and enable you to really stretch when you need to.” Some great advice within. I don’t agree with all, but it’s generally too good to miss.
